EDINBURG,TX--The University of Texas-Pan American men's golf program captured the UTPA Golf Classic title this afternoon, Tuesday (Nov. 3), at the Los Lagos Golf Club in Edinburg, Texas.
"We are very excited about winning our home tournament. Armen came through today shooting the team's best round of the tournament (71) helping our team make up the four strokes we needed to take first place," said head men's golf coach Santiago Larrea. "The guys are very excited about this win. I know we will build on this win to take us into the spring season where the schedule is a bit stronger."
After the first day, the Broncs were in second place behind Houston Baptist. The second and final day was another story, as the Broncs stormed back behind the solid play of the entire team. The Broncs made up the difference (four strokes) and took first place by six strokes.
The Broncs were led by Kevin Kirakossian (Tualatin, OR/Tualatin H.S.) who fired a three-round total of 223, finishing tied for third place. Armen Kirakossian (Portland, OR/Wilson H.S.), Brandon Reyna (Mission, TX/Sharyland H.S.) and Orlando Moreno (Donna, TX/UT-Brownsville) each shot a three-round total of 225, with all three ending tied for fifth place.
High Wongchindawest (Bangkok, Thailand/Heritage Academy) shot a three-round score of 238, placing him tied for 15th place, while teammate Adam Haley shot a 243 for the tournament, which put him tied for 20th place. A.J. Gonzalez (Edcouch,TX/Edcouch-Elsa H.S.) shot a 247 for the tournament landing him in 22nd place.
The UTPA Golf Classic concludes the fall season for the Broncs.
